How the neighbourhood rates living here
Bar = place among all Dutch neighbourhoods, from the lowest figure to the highest. Grey = the middle half of neighbourhoods, tick = the national figure.
76.3%satisfied with their home
Lower than in 97% of neighbourhoods
23.7% not (very) satisfiedNetherlands 90.1% · 13.8 pt
71.5%satisfied with their neighbourhood
Lower than in 97% of neighbourhoods
28.5% not (very) satisfiedNetherlands 88.1% · 16.6 pt

Share of adults in the neighbourhood who are (very) satisfied, RIVM Health Monitor 2024. The bar lines the neighbourhood up against all 11,734 neighbourhoods with a figure in the monitor: half of them sit between 87 and 93 percent, so a few points move a neighbourhood from the middle to the tail. "Not (very) satisfied" is neutral and dissatisfied together, because the monitor does not publish those two separately. A neighbourhood average, so it says nothing about this particular home.

Source Police/CBS, neighbourhood level, latest full calendar year. Only crimes reported to the police; willingness to report differs by offence and by area. A neighbourhood with shops or nightlife counts visitors’ reports too, so busy does not automatically mean unsafe.

Liveability class: sufficient

Leefbaarometer 3.0 (Dutch Ministry of the Interior / RIGO), 2024 edition. The scale is by definition a deviation from the national average: 0 IS the Netherlands, and that is the tick on the bar. The bar itself is the place among all neighbourhoods, because they do not sit symmetrically around zero: the same small minus is mid-pack on one sub-scale and the tail on another. A model score for the whole neighbourhood, not a measurement at this address. Resident mix stays grey: a different population is not better or worse, only different.
